Join our new Ambulatory Surgery Center and provide high-quality, patient-centered care that supports patients through their surgical journey-from pre-operative preparation to post-anesthesia recovery and discharge. As a Pre/Post RN, you will be part of the Advocate Health Nursing Professional Governance community, delivering evidence-based, compassionate care and collaborating across interdisciplinary teams to ensure safe and exceptional patient experiences. This role is ideal for a dynamic and detail-oriented nurse who thrives in a fast-paced ambulatory environment and values teamwork, communication, and professional growth.
Essential Functions
- Engages in unit councils, shared governance activities, and quality initiatives to improve processes and support evidence-based practice.
- Utilizes the nursing process to assess, plan, diagnose, implement, and evaluate care in both pre-op and post-op environments.
- Educates and supports patients and families through the peri-operative experience to ensure understanding, safety, and comfort.
- Monitors patient conditions, identifies changes, adjusts care plans, and collaborates with the care team to influence outcomes.
- Upholds and advocates for a strong culture of safety for patients, families, and staff.
- Continuously evaluates patient, team, and unit outcomes and takes action to improve quality of care.
- Administers medications, treatments, and therapies safely and according to ASC protocols and professional standards.
- Demonstrates strong communication skills, conflict resolution, and the ability to delegate appropriately within scope and policy.
- Pursues ongoing professional development and maintains required certifications and competencies.
- Adheres to the ANA Code of Ethics and demonstrates ethical practice, respect for all disciplines, and a commitment to unbiased, patient-centered care.
- Maintains accurate, timely, and legally compliant EHR documentation.
- Floats between ASC areas (pre-op, PACU, Phase II recovery) or to other designated care areas as needed.
- Provides age-appropriate and developmentally appropriate care based on established department standards.
Minimum Job Requirements
Education
- Graduate of a Board of Nursing-approved nursing education program.
- Active, unrestricted Registered Nurse (RN) license-multi-state compact or single-state license with privileges to practice where patient care is delivered.
- Basic Life Support (BLS) required.
- Additional specialty certifications (e.g., ACLS, PALS) may be required based on departmental needs.
- Typically requires 1 year of clinical nursing experience.
- Ambulatory surgery, PACU, or peri-anesthesia experience preferred.
- Strong clinical judgment and critical-thinking skills.
- Effective prioritization, time management, and problem-solving abilities.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
- Ability to work efficiently in a fast-paced ASC environment.
- Proficiency using electronic health records and digital clinical platforms.
Preferred Qualifications
-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N)

About Advocate Health
Advocate Health is the third-largest nonprofit, integrated health system in the United States, created from the combination of Advocate Aurora Health and Atrium Health. Providing care under the names Advocate Health Care in Illinois; Atrium Health in the Carolinas, Georgia and Alabama; and Aurora Health Care in Wisconsin, Advocate Health is a national leader in clinical innovation, health outcomes, consumer experience and value-based care. Headquartered in Charlotte, North Carolina, Advocate Health services nearly 6 million patients and is engaged in hundreds of clinical trials and research studies, with Wake Forest University School of Medicine serving as the academic core of the enterprise. It is nationally recognized for its expertise in cardiology, neurosciences, oncology, pediatrics and rehabilitation, as well as organ transplants, burn treatments and specialized musculoskeletal programs. Advocate Health employs 155,000 teammates across 69 hospitals and over 1,000 care locations, and offers one of the nation's largest graduate medical education programs with over 2,000 residents and fellows across more than 200 programs. Committed to providing equitable care for all, Advocate Health provides more than $6 billion in annual community benefits.
